Lithologic Log
(Log data entered by KGS.)
From: 0 ft. to 1 ft. silt
From: 1 ft. to 20 ft. sandy clay caliche
From: 20 ft. to 49 ft. sandy clay
From: 49 ft. to 62 ft. sand gravel sandstone
From: 62 ft. to 83 ft. sand clay sand
From: 83 ft. to 90 ft. fine sand medium sand clay
From: 90 ft. to 113 ft. sandy clay sand
From: 113 ft. to 122 ft. sand clay
From: 122 ft. to 143 ft. clay caliche sandstone
From: 143 ft. to 182 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 182 ft. to 240 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 240 ft. to 246 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 246 ft. to 255 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 255 ft. to 323 ft. shale
From: 323 ft. to 340 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 340 ft. to 342 ft. limestone
From: 342 ft. to 360 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 360 ft. to 367 ft. sandstone caliche shale
From: 367 ft. to 374 ft. sandstone caliche
From: 374 ft. to 389 ft. sandstone clay caliche
From: 389 ft. to 409 ft. sandstone clay
From: 409 ft. to 414 ft. caliche shale
From: 414 ft. to 457 ft. sandstone caliche shale
From: 457 ft. to 464 ft. sandstone shale
From: 464 ft. to 534 ft. sandstone caliche clay
From: 534 ft. to 539 ft. caliche clay
From: 539 ft. to 549 ft. clay
From: 549 ft. to 564 ft. caliche sandstone clay
From: 564 ft. to 590 ft. caliche sandstone
From: 590 ft. to 600 ft. shale
